Anycubic Kobra 3 Combo review
The cheapest route into four-colour printing, and the ACE Pro doubles as a filament dryer. Slower and messier than an AMS, but hundreds cheaper.
Best for: Multi-colour on the cheapest possible budget.
What we like
- Multi-colour bundle at a low price
- Built-in filament drying
- Big 250 mm bed
What we don't
- Colour changes are slow and waste filament
- Open frame
- Software rough around the edges
Full specifications
| Type | FDM bedslinger |
| Released | 2024 |
| Build volume | 250 × 250 × 260 mm |
| Max speed | 600 mm/s |
| Hotend max temp | 300 °C |
| Bed max temp | 110 °C |
| Nozzle | 0.4 mm |
| Bed levelling | Automatic |
| Enclosure | No |
| Multi-material | ACE Pro included (4 colours + drying) |
| Connectivity | Wi-Fi, USB |
| Recommended slicer | Anycubic Slicer / Orca |
Specifications are the manufacturer's published figures. "Max speed" is a headline number no printer sustains across a whole part — treat it as a ceiling, not a throughput estimate.
